The front disc brake caliper:

  • bolts to the front disc brake caliper anchor plate, which bolts to the front wheel spindle.
  • is a disc brake caliper locating pin, dual piston design.
  • has a fluid inlet at the center of the caliper housing.

The brake disc:

  • is of a ventilated full-cast design, with non-directional cooling fins.
  • is serviced with the disc brake caliper and front disc brake caliper anchor plate removed.

The brake disc shield:

  • is riveted to the front wheel spindle.
  • protects the front wheel bearings and inboard surface of the brake disc.

The pads:

  • are housed in the front disc brake caliper anchor plate.
  • are of a non-asbestos, low-metallic composition.
